/*!
* swiped-events.js - v@version@
* Pure JavaScript swipe events
* https://github.com/john-doherty/swiped-events
* @inspiration https://stackoverflow.com/questions/16348031/disable-scrolling-when-touch-moving-certain-element
* @author John Doherty <www.johndoherty.info>
* @license MIT
*/
;(function (window, document) {
'use strict'
// patch CustomEvent to allow constructor creation (IE/Chrome)
if (typeof window.CustomEvent !== 'function') {
window.CustomEvent = function (event, params) {
params = params || {
bubbles: false,
cancelable: false,
detail: undefined,
}
var evt = document.createEvent('CustomEvent')
evt.initCustomEvent(
event,
params.bubbles,
params.cancelable,
params.detail
)
return evt
}
window.CustomEvent.prototype = window.Event.prototype
}
document.addEventListener('touchstart', handleTouchStart, false)
document.addEventListener('touchmove', handleTouchMove, false)
document.addEventListener('touchend', handleTouchEnd, false)
var xDown = null
var yDown = null
var xDiff = null
var yDiff = null
var timeDown = null
var startEl = null
/**
* Fires swiped event if swipe detected on touchend
* @param {object} e - browser event object
* @returns {void}
*/
function handleTouchEnd(e) {
// if the user released on a different target, cancel!
if (startEl !== e.target) return
var swipeThreshold = parseInt(
getNearestAttribute(startEl, 'data-swipe-threshold', '20'),
10
) // default 20px
var swipeTimeout = parseInt(
getNearestAttribute(startEl, 'data-swipe-timeout', '500'),
10
) // default 500ms
var timeDiff = Date.now() - timeDown
var eventType = ''
var changedTouches = e.changedTouches || e.touches || []
if (Math.abs(xDiff) > Math.abs(yDiff)) {
// most significant
if (Math.abs(xDiff) > swipeThreshold && timeDiff < swipeTimeout) {
if (xDiff > 0) {
eventType = 'swiped-left'
} else {
eventType = 'swiped-right'
}
}
} else if (
Math.abs(yDiff) > swipeThreshold &&
timeDiff < swipeTimeout
) {
if (yDiff > 0) {
eventType = 'swiped-up'
} else {
eventType = 'swiped-down'
}
}
if (eventType !== '') {
var eventData = {
dir: eventType.replace(/swiped-/, ''),
touchType: (changedTouches[0] || {}).touchType || 'direct',
xStart: parseInt(xDown, 10),
xEnd: parseInt((changedTouches[0] || {}).clientX || -1, 10),
yStart: parseInt(yDown, 10),
yEnd: parseInt((changedTouches[0] || {}).clientY || -1, 10),
}
// fire `swiped` event event on the element that started the swipe
startEl.dispatchEvent(
new CustomEvent('swiped', {
bubbles: true,
cancelable: true,
detail: eventData,
})
)
// fire `swiped-dir` event on the element that started the swipe
startEl.dispatchEvent(
new CustomEvent(eventType, {
bubbles: true,
cancelable: true,
detail: eventData,
})
)
}
// reset values
xDown = null
yDown = null
timeDown = null
}
/**
* Records current location on touchstart event
* @param {object} e - browser event object
* @returns {void}
*/
function handleTouchStart(e) {
// if the element has data-swipe-ignore="true" we stop listening for swipe events
if (e.target.getAttribute('data-swipe-ignore') === 'true') return
startEl = e.target
timeDown = Date.now()
xDown = e.touches[0].clientX
yDown = e.touches[0].clientY
xDiff = 0
yDiff = 0
}
/**
* Records location diff in px on touchmove event
* @param {object} e - browser event object
* @returns {void}
*/
function handleTouchMove(e) {
if (!xDown || !yDown) return
var xUp = e.touches[0].clientX
var yUp = e.touches[0].clientY
xDiff = xDown - xUp
yDiff = yDown - yUp
}
/**
* Gets attribute off HTML element or nearest parent
* @param {object} el - HTML element to retrieve attribute from
* @param {string} attributeName - name of the attribute
* @param {any} defaultValue - default value to return if no match found
* @returns {any} attribute value or defaultValue
*/
function getNearestAttribute(el, attributeName, defaultValue) {
// walk up the dom tree looking for attributeName
while (el && el !== document.documentElement) {
var attributeValue = el.getAttribute(attributeName)
if (attributeValue) {
return attributeValue
}
el = el.parentNode
}
return defaultValue
}
})(window, document)
